Cheapest Available Greenbriar Club 1 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it Greenbriar Club of Tampa, FL is the 1 X 1 Model starting from $1,149 at Highland Park.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Greenbriar Club is currently $1,569.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in the area:

Apartment ListingModel NamePriced From
Highland Park1 X 1$1,149
Chesapeake101 - 1 Bdrm, 1 Bath$1,174
Serenity LaneThe Greater Serenity (A1)$1,195
The Carlisle at DunedinA1$1,212
The Palms at Countryside ApartmentsA2 - Bayshore Terrace$1,249
Pineview ApartmentsThe Sand$1,399
MacAlpine PlaceBarclay$1,478
Avana LakeviewOne Bedroom One Bath (791 SF)$1,485
The Alexander at CountrysideA1A$1,675
Windsor ClearwaterA1-T$1,783

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Greenbriar Club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Greenbriar Club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Greenbriar Club is $1,569.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Greenbriar Club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Greenbriar Club is a 1,003 square feet unit starting from $1,736 at MacAlpine Place.

What is the average size for Greenbriar Club 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Greenbriar Club is currently 550 sq ft.
